NetApp Certified Implementation Engineer—Data Protection Specialists have proven skills in positioning NetApp disaster recovery solutions, assessing customer data storage requirements, and implementing backup and recovery solutions.
NCIE Data Protection logos and certificates will be granted to those individuals who successfully obtain NetApp Certified Data Administrator, ONTAP (NCDA) certification, then pass the NetApp Certified Implementation Engineer—Data Protection (NS0-513) exam.
NS0-513
NetApp Certified Implementation Engineer—Data Protection
The NS0-513 exam includes 60 test questions, with an allotted time of 1-1/2 hours to complete. In countries where English is not the native language, candidates for whom English is not their first language will be granted a 30-minute extension to the allotted examination completion time.
The NS0-513 exam includes the following topics:
ONTAP Replication Technology
Describe how ONTAP replication technology works within a NetApp Data Fabric including Snapshot copies and SnapMirror replication
Describe how high-availability configurations operate within an ONTAP Cluster
Describe how a MetroCluster configuration can ensure business continuity
Identify the difference between synchronous and asynchronous replication for applications and VM
Planning ONTAP Data Protection Implementation
Identify ONTAP data protection solutions in traditional on-premise configurations, private clouds, hybrid cloud, and storage tiering environments
Demonstrate how to apply ONTAP guidelines and use tools: sizing guidelines, Interoperability Matrix Tool, RPO calculator, Savings Calculator, Hardware Universe
Describe the implementation steps for application- and virtualization-specific workloads, including Snapshot retention policies
Distinguish between a consistent file system and an application-consistent backup
Demonstrate how to develop a course of action to recover customer ONTAP data after a disaster
Identify how to implement security related to ONTAP data protection: NetApp Volume Encryption, NetApp Security Encryption, SnapLock, key management
Describe how to plan for ONTAP data protection in the Data Fabric
Configuring Data Protection Software
Describe how to configure ONTAP Snapshots, SnapMirror policies, SnapMirror for SVMs, and MetroCluster using the command-line interface and System Manager
Identify which tool to use to set up ONTAP-based storage and schedule policies
Operating Data Protection Deployments
Demonstrate how to back up or restore NAS, SAN, VM, object and application data using ONTAP
Demonstrate how to locate and protect unprotected ONTAP volumes using OnCommand Unified Manager
Describe how to use WorkFlow Automator (WFA) products to orchestrate failover and failback for application servers
Describe how to use SnapCenter as an external backup application
Describe how to verify that backup and replication jobs are up-to-date
Demonstrate how to validate that an ONTAP backup is successfully restored
Best Practices
Describe strategies for implementing ONTAP data protection products in the data fabric using SnapMirror, MetroCluster, Unified Data Replication (UDP), network compression, Cloud Backup
Describe how to calculate transfer time based on the customer's available bandwidth and latency distance for ONTAP data protection products
Describe storage efficiency for ONTAP data protection
Describe automation policies for managing volume capacity
Describe monitoring or reporting techniques for ONTAP data protection solutions
